For grid-connected systems, the very first consideration is to determine if you desire a central string inverter, a string look at this site inverter with component optimizers, or a micro-inverter system. String inverters normally set you back 10% to 20% less than optimizer or micro-inverter systems. They have a 15 to twenty years anticipated efficiency life. String inverter service warranties normally cover 10 years, and many producers supply optional prolonged service warranties as much as twenty years.

This implies that each photovoltaic panel can operate individually of the panels around it. Optimizer and Micro-inverter systems normally set you back 10% to 20% more and call for additional cable televisions and equipment, but they can generate more power, especially in shaded problems - Zendure Solar Kits. Research studies reveal that with complete, straight sunshine, a micro-inverter system may generate 2% to 3% even more power than a string inverter system


They commonly have 25 year service warranties and a longer performance lifetime. Optimizers and Micro-inverters are wonderful for easy system growth, and they work much better in locations that have shading or different roof surface areas. They call for a monitoring system to track performance and fix each individual module if required. Solar panels can be mounted on a roof-top or pole-mounted on the ground.




Post mounting is used when there is not nearly enough south-facing roofing room or there are unusual roof surfaces. Roof-top solar panels can be affixed to most any kind of pitched roof covering surface including structure or asphalt shingle, flat concrete tiles, curved or S-tile, slate, timber shake or metal roof coverings

Photovoltaic panel can be also tilt-mounted on level roofing systems making use of accessories or non-penetrating ballast trays for all sorts of level roof surface areas. There are a few variations of ground-mounted photovoltaic panels. One of the most common is a multi-pole ground place utilizing numerous concrete piers and 2" or 3" galvanized steel blog posts.
